Transaction 8746966334bfc1fd4fa64fd3e9b07dc5bdbd6cca4f67afac15614e62599fb0f1
1 Input
1 Output
-
8746966334bfc1fd4fa64fd3e9b07dc5bdbd6cca4f67afac15614e62599fb0f1:0
- value
- 384516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da0e95d96a2ea407f9386af89a811d1194e8141d OP_EQUAL
- address
- 3MZzhmeVPxCTUMWV4KNA8bnUJi3q3RySuJ